Alex, SAC,

It seems that it's not the first time that there is confusion about how to handle domain renewals. The best solution for the future may be to share responsibility for domain renewals between SAC and the treasurer.

At the moment I do not get the renewal notices, so if treasurer at osgeo could be added to the dnscontact at osgeo email alias then I would receive them, and could coordinate with SAC to proceed with paying for the renewal when we get a notice.

Let's also keep in mind that future treasurers may not be as comfortable as I am with managing domains, that's why I think it is important that SAC remains involved in the renewals and we do not make that the sole responsibility of the treasurer.

Folks,

I have renewed postgis.net for five years. I had originally set the registration at 1 year in the hopes we might be able to return to postgis.org as the primary domain.

As requested, I have added the treasurer@osgeo.org address to the dnscontact alias so that the treasurer will be notified of billing related information.

Now that there is a card associated with pairnic, SAC members (on dnscontact - Alex, myself and Howard current) should be able to renew stuff as needed. If anyone else would like to be on the dnscontact alias let me know.
